Also, a big part of the inefficiency in conventional power collection (in the case of solar) is transmission losses in the power lines. This converts light directly into microwave energy that can then be transmitted without power lines. That's a game hanger, just like wifi is to ethernet

High voltage power lines have losses of 0.5% to 1% per 100 miles. Beaming power from space microwaves would have a total loss of 40-60%.

And that doesn't include the cost (both money and carbon) of launching all the collection and transmission equipment into space in the first place.

High voltage power lines also cost $800k-$2mil per mile just to construct.

Can someone please explain the picture in the article: Why are the technicians dressed like astronauts? They're not going to space in the vehicle.
Hydrazine (used for maneuvering thrusters) is not your friend. Tanks will not be fully empty — draining them safely requires safety gear.

No, it almost definitely isn't. The cost-benefit analysis of doing that completely fails at almost every imaginable level.

Not only would it fail to increase American nuclear strike/retaliation capabilities by any meaningful margin, but if discovered it would set off a massive nuclear arms race in space which would be massively destabilizing and benefits no-one which is exactly why all the major players signed that "no nukes in space" treaty in the first place.

> It's a great first strike weapon without a detectable missile launch. If terrorists are building a nuke you can drop it on them and make it look like they blew themselves up. Last ditch asteroid defense.

No to all points. Nukes don't just unintentionally go off and hypothetically if the did people on the ground wouldn't normally expect the very noticeable trail of a reentry vehicle screaming in from space immediately beforehand. That kind of thing is very noticeable, go look at ICBM test footage. If you want to nuke someone without warning you use stealthy cruise missiles because those don't tend to get noticed until they detonate. Any nuke carried by the X-37 also lacks the delta V to ever get to any dangerous asteroid you might want to try to intercept.

With all the junk we have orbiting over our heads, it would probably be a lot cheaper to just reach and deorbit some of the larger debris in a controlled way, rather than bring all that weight up there, or even do that with some of the enemy satellites if they have them: two birds with one stone.
Most satellites are intended to break up on reentry, or would whether intended to or not because of how they'd end up hitting the atmosphere and their relatively large surface areas and shape (they're very far from aerodynamic). Kinetic weapons would need a different physical composition (denser material and different shape) and more deliberate manner of launching (or dropping?) than you'd be able to pull off from existing satellites.
